It seems highly unlikely that the Minnesota Vikings will acquire Pro Bowl edge rusher Joey Bosa before the start of the 2026 NFL season.

One hot name that has swirled around in rumors is Joey Bosa. The 30-year-old edge rusher is currently a free agent, and there are quite a few Minnesota Vikings fans who like the idea of bringing the No. 3 overall pick in the 2016 NFL Draft to the NFC North.

At a time when most free agents would be panicking and hounding their agents to get them offers and workouts, it is being reported that Bosa doesn't have football on his mind at all. That means joining the Vikings might be a pipe dream.

NFL insider Adam Schefter likely broke a lot of fans' hearts during a recent podcast. During the podcast, he had this to say about Bosa's NFL future:

"It is more likely than not that Joey Bosa has played his last NFL down. Now again, could a situation like the 49ers come along that entices him enough to come out and play again? Yeah. Absolutely. We saw it happen last year with Phillip Rivers. So you never know when a player is fully done and when he's not done."

When talking about situations that might entice Joey Bosa to return to the football field, it is unlikely that the Vikings would be on that list. Playing for Brian Flores might be great for him, but there would be something special if he could join his brother Nick in San Francisco
